Traditional liquid foundations rely on basic oil-in-water (O/W) emulsions—where oil droplets are suspended in water. While effective for light coverage, they often fail after 6–8 hours in humid conditions. Modern formulations now use nano-emulsion systems that reduce droplet size to below 100 nanometers, creating a more stable and skin-adherent film.
| Feature | Traditional Emulsion | Nano-Emulsion System |
|---|---|---|
| Droplet Size | 300–500 nm | <100 nm |
| Water Resistance (Lab Test) | 4–6 hrs | 10–14 hrs |
| Skin Adhesion | Moderate | High |
This advancement doesn’t just improve wear time—it enhances texture, allowing for a thinner, more breathable finish. According to a 2023 Euromonitor report, over 72% of global beauty buyers prioritize “long-lasting” as their top purchase driver when selecting foundation products.
To validate performance, we conducted controlled tests in environments simulating tropical climates (35°C, 85% humidity). Foundations using nano-emulsion lasted up to 12 hours without transfer, while traditional formulas showed visible breakdown within 6 hours.
